        My experience with Latisse for Scalp hair growth

        I had thinning scalp since 2005. I tried Minoxidil for 6 months. I could barely see some positive effect. Then, Allergan's Latisse came out. So, I added it into 5% Minoxidil. Minoxidil solution has a lot of organic solvent. After appliying the solution, Bimatoprost would get concentrated after solvents have evaporated. After just two months of usage, my wife told me my scap hairs recovered 80%. However, I got allergic to the mixed solution. I had to stop using it. 7 months after I stopped, my scalp lost 90% of original hair.
        Members here talked about higher concentration rather than 0.03%. However, the maximum solubility of Bimatoprost is 0.03% in water.
